How is Boston ACT tutoring different from classroom learning?
Unlike traditional classroom lessons, Boston ACT tutoring gives your student the chance to work closely with a qualified instructor in a one-on-one setting. They get to receive the undivided attention of their tutor, meaning they're able to benefit from constructive feedback and meaningful explanations that can help them better understand difficult concepts.
What's more, your student never has to worry about keeping up with the pace of the class because there's no ready-made curriculum to follow. The content covered in the lessons can be designed specifically for your student, focusing on the areas they need to work on. This allows your student to spend more time on areas that are especially challenging for them to understand, while lightly touching on the topics they've already mastered.
One of the biggest advantages of Boston ACT tutoring is the ability to learn through personalized lessons. Your student can prepare for the ACT in a way that works best for them. Their academic mentor understands there isn't a one-size-fits-all approach to learning and can consider your student's personality and preferred learning styles when creating content for lessons.
If your student is an auditory learner, their instructor can include more discussions in the study sessions. If your student prefers to learn through visuals, their tutor can implement more infographics and images in the lesson. Working with Boston ACT tutors can increase the chances of your student learning in a way that's fun and effective, which can help them feel more positive about the ACT.
Boston ACT tutoring also gives your student more control over the directions of their lessons. They can work with Boston ACT tutors to review all areas of the ACT, or they can focus on a specific section like reading or science. If your student is taking the optional ACT Plus Writing section of the exam, their tutor can help them improve their writing skills by teaching your student how to write structured essays. Boston ACT tutors can even narrow the focus of one or more lessons down to specific subjects covered in the ACT, like English grammar, chemistry, and critical reading. This can help your student utilize their study time more efficiently by shifting the focus to major areas they need to work on.
What are the benefits of having my student study with Boston ACT tutors near me?
Boston ACT tutors can help your student work through their challenges through one-on-one assistance. What's more, they can keep track of your student's progress, measuring how much they've improved between each study session. They can then use this information to help them plan future lessons, so the content covered in each study session is more likely to help push your student closer to their desired outcomes.
The goal of Boston ACT tutoring is to help your student prepare for their upcoming assessment, and part of doing well on the ACT is developing good test-taking skills. The focus of private lessons isn't limited to the subjects covered on the ACT.
Your student can also learn valuable test-taking strategies to help them do their best when taking the exam. Their tutor can teach them how to manage time, so they're less likely to rush through the test. They can learn how to identify important information from questions and problems, how to spot the subtle differences between two or more multiple-choice answers that look the same, and various tips that can help them reduce the impact of test-day jitters.
There's always the chance your student could memorize the wrong information when studying for the ACT by themselves. Boston ACT tutoring can prevent this from happening, giving your student the chance to study with someone who can check their work. An academic mentor can ensure your student is learning the correct information, so that they're more likely to make informed decisions when it's time to take the test.
As a parent, you can also benefit from your student's private lessons. Their instructor can teach you ways to help your student with their studies. You can learn about different ACT supplemental material you can review with your student, or different ways you can create a comfortable learning environment for your student.
